Susanne Somerville is the CEO of Chronicled, builders of enterprise blockchain solutions for the life sciences and healthcare industry. In this podcast Susanne introduced us to both Chronicled and to MediLedger whilst sharing some insights on how they are tackling some of the inefficiencies in the US healthcare system.

You will also hear about some of her learnings about the differences of launching blockchain solutions based on regulatory compliance compared to one of ROI.

Susanne’s prior experience is in the life sciences where she ran supply chain for pharmaceutical and biotech companies like Genentech and Hoffman LaRoche.

What is the state of US healthcare industry and how digitised, connected and standardised is it?
Photograph by Robert Kaufmann

According to the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services, the US National health spending is projected to grow at an average annual rate of 5.4 percent for 2019-28 and to reach $6.2 trillion by 2028.

In comparison to many other countries the US healthcare system is private, which has spurred on a lot of innovation. Due to that a lot of the innovation was done on an individual level, creating many disparate systems across the country. Susanne’s experience is that US healthcare companies are analogue native instead of digital. A lot is still being done on paper and on fax machines. All of this has contributed to create a disconnected US healthcare industry.

A recent report mentioned that even in exciting technology such as AI (artificial intelligence) there was only a 2% adoption rate of it in the US healthcare industry.

 
Chronicled & MediLedger
Chronicled is based out of San Francisco and it has been tackling connecting the physical to the digital world since 2014. They were looking at a variety of industry use cases and found a sweet spot in the life sciences. In 2017 they launched the MediLedger project to bring together industry leaders to see how blockchain could play a role in meeting regulations and fixing a lot of the issues in their industry.

Since 2017, the project has morphed into the MediLedger Network. Chronicle is the builder of the software solution and is the custodian of the network. The consortium members of MediLedger run the infrastructure and the solution so that they have control over how the network grows.
